Laji.fi | Tietoja foorumista | Käyttöehdot | Yksityisyys | Keskustelusuosituksia

LAJI.FI-foorumi

Alueena ympyrä - keskipisteen koordinaatit?

#1

Saako Vihkosta tai Laji.fi:stä mistään selville käytetyn havaintoympyrän keskipistettä ja sädettä? Nyt nuo ympyrälle ilmoitetut koordinaatit ovat koordinaattialue, jonka sisään ympyrä mahtuu, mikä tarkoittaa käytännössä neliötä, jos alue ilmoitetaan muodossa Lat1-Lat2:Lon1-Lon2. Tuleeko tässä pientä epätarkkuutta havaintoilmoitusten ja hakujen välillä, jos ilmoituksissa käytetään ympyröitä? Vai hoidetaanko tämä järjestelmän sisällä kuitenkin oikein?

Jos käytän karttapalvelua, voin kuitenkin normaalisti piirtää ympyrän, jossa valitsen keskipisteen ja vedän siitä tietyn säteisen ympyrän. Nyt tarvitsisin oman ympyrän keskipisteen, enkä keksi muuta keinoa kuin sen hakemisen karttapalvelusta, jolloin siinä voi olla pieni ero piirrettyyn nähden.

#2

Hoksasin juuri, että saanhan minä sen keskipisteen poistamalla koordinaattien jälkimmäisestä luvusta ensimmäisen ja jakamalla summan kahtia ja lisäämällä sen ensimmäiseen… Toivoisin helpompaakin tapaa. :slight_smile:

#3

Vihko muuntaa ympyrän tallennusvaiheessa monikulmioksi, koska alueen tallennuksessa käytetty GeoJSON-standardi ei hyväksy ympyränmuotoisia (piste+säde) alueita. Tämä tekee asiasta vähän hankalan hallita. En nyt osaa sanoa saako datasta keskipistettä ulos muuten kuin laskemalla, vaikka laskennankin voisimme kyllä automatisoida.

Itse olen joskus kirjannut havaintoalueen ympyränä ja sitten tarkan havainnoijan (minun tapauksessani äänityslaitteen) sijainnin lisäksi pisteenä.

1 Like
#4

Olen itse lähinnä käyttänyt laajempaa aluetta yleisenä rajana ja parempien lajien osalta kirjannut havaintokohtaisesti tarkemman paikan.

Nyt ymmärrän, miksei rajapinnan kautta myöskään ympyränmuotoisen alueen havaintojen haku onnistu, vaan pitää määritellä suorakulmio.